Overview DR Cvdol 6.25mg Tablet

Cardiovasc 6.25mg tablets effectively manage hypertension, angina pectoris, and congestive heart failure. This medication facilitates improved cardiac blood flow by promoting vasodilation. Consequently, it reduces the risk of myocardial infarction and cerebrovascular accident. Administer Cardiovasc 6.25mg tablets with food, adhering strictly to your physician's prescribed dosage and regimen. Consistent use is crucial, even if you feel healthy or your blood pressure is regulated. Discontinuation requires medical consultation to prevent potential complications. Lifestyle modifications, such as regular physical activity, weight management, smoking cessation, moderate alcohol consumption, and a low-sodium diet (as directed by your doctor), significantly enhance treatment outcomes. While generally well-tolerated, potential side effects include lightheadedness, cephalalgia, dyspnea, and fatigue. Report any persistent or bothersome adverse effects to your doctor. Prior to initiating treatment, disclose any pre-existing cardiac or renal conditions, and pregnant or lactating individuals should seek medical counsel before use.

How DR Cvdol 6.25mg Tablet works:

Cvdol 6.25mg tablets combine alpha and beta-blocking properties. This dual action reduces heart rate and dilates blood vessels, thereby improving the heart's pumping efficiency.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holUNSAFE

Consuming alcohol while taking DR Cvdol 6.25mg Tablets is inadvisable.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of DR Cvdol 6.25mg T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the advantages against possible dangers prior to prescribing. Always seek medical advice.

Breast feedingBreast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Cvdol 6.25mg tablets appear safe for breastfeeding mothers. Available human data indicates minimal risk to the infant.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Taking a 6.25mg DR Cvdol tablet might cause drowsiness, blurred vision, or dizziness.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.

KidneyKid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Cvdol 6.25mg tablets can be used safely by individuals with kidney disease; dosage modification isn't typically necessary. Nevertheless, disclose any pre-existing kidney conditions to your physician. Routine blood pressure monitoring is advised to guide dosage decisions.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Cvdol 6.25mg tablets require careful administration in individuals with hepatic impairment. Dosage modification of Cvdol 6.25mg tablets may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ised. Cvdol 6.25mg tablets are contraindicated in patients exhibiting severe liver dysfunction.

What if you forget to take DR Cvdol 6.25mg Tablet :

Should you forget a DR Cvdol 6.25mg Tablet dose, administer it immediately.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on DR Cvdol 6.25mg Tablet

Take DR Cvdol 6.25mg tablets regularly as prescribed. Abruptly stopping the medication may lead to chest pain or a heart attack. Your doctor will gradually reduce your dosage before discontinuation, if necessary.
Yes, DR Cvdol 6.25mg Tablets can cause tiredness and dizziness, especially at the start of treatment or after a dose increase. Avoid driving or operating machinery if affected.
Weight gain is a possible side effect of DR Cvdol 6.25mg Tablets, though not universal. If you're using this medication for heart failure, report any weight gain or breathing difficulties to your doctor immediately, as these could indicate fluid retention.
DR Cvdol 6.25mg Tablet may rarely worsen kidney function in heart failure patients. The risk of kidney failure is increased in patients with low blood pressure (systolic below 100 mm Hg), hardened arteries, pre-existing heart disease, or impaired kidney function. Close monitoring is essential for these patients during treatment. Kidney function typically recovers after discontinuing DR Cvdol 6.25mg Tablet.
Diabetic patients can take DR Cvdol 6.25mg tablets, but regular blood glucose monitoring is crucial. Studies show minimal impact on blood glucose in well-controlled diabetics with mild-to-moderate hypertension. However, beta-blockers like DR Cvdol can mask hypoglycemia symptoms, such as increased heart rate. Furthermore, it may worsen hyperglycemia in diabetic patients with heart failure. Therefore, consistent blood glucose monitoring is essential throughout DR Cvdol 6.25mg therapy, including initiation, dose adjustment, and discontinuation. Report any blood glucose changes to your doctor immediately.
Taking your DR Cvdol 6.25mg Tablet with food is advised. Food slows absorption, minimizing the risk of orthostatic hypotension (dizziness or fainting upon standing).
Taking DR Cvdol 6.25mg Tablets may lead to serious side effects including fainting, breathing difficulties, weight gain, and swelling in the extremities (arms, hands, feet, ankles, or lower legs). Other possible side effects are chest pain, abnormal heartbeat, rash, hives, itching, and trouble breathing or swallowing. Seek immediate medical attention if any of these occur.
Overdosing on DR Cvdol 6.25mg Tablets can cause slowed heart rate, dizziness, fainting, breathing difficulties, vomiting, unconsciousness, or seizures. Seek immediate medical attention at the nearest hospital and contact your doctor.
Patients with severe heart failure requiring ICU admission or inotropic medications, those with asthma or breathing difficulties, bradycardia or arrhythmia, liver impairment, or a DR Cvdol 6.25mg Tablet allergy should not use this medication.
